Understanding When It’s Time for a Hearing Test
Hearing loss often develops slowly, making it easy to miss early warning signs. Many people wait too long before seeking help, assuming it’s just background noise or temporary fatigue. 1. You Often Ask People to Repeat Themselves
If you frequently find yourself saying, “What did you say?” or “Can you repeat that?”, it may indicate that your ears aren’t picking up speech as clearly as they used to. This is especially noticeable in crowded places or when multiple people are talking. A hearing test can identify whether this is due to hearing loss or another issue like wax buildup.
2. Conversations Sound Muffled or Unclear
When speech starts to sound like mumbling, even from familiar voices, it’s a strong signal to visit a hearing center in Attingal for evaluation. Subtle hearing changes can distort sounds, especially consonants like “s,” “t,” and “f,” which are crucial for speech clarity.
3. You Turn Up the TV or Phone Volume Frequently
If family members or friends often comment that your TV or phone is too loud, it might be your ears trying to compensate for reduced hearing. A hearing test at Sound Plus Hearing Center can determine the exact degree of hearing loss and suggest solutions that let you enjoy entertainment at a comfortable level again.
4. You Feel Tired After Social Gatherings
Listening with untreated hearing loss requires extra effort. Many people describe feeling mentally drained after long conversations or meetings. This “listening fatigue” is a common but often overlooked sign that you may need a hearing test. Getting your hearing checked can make communication far less exhausting.
5. You Avoid Noisy Environments or Group Discussions
If you’ve started avoiding restaurants, family gatherings, or meetings because it’s hard to follow conversations, it’s time to take action.
